FRANZ project in Munich: ABG leases longterm to Alvarez & Marsal

•    ABG Real Estate Group to let 3,000 sqm
•    70 per cent of FRANZ office space already let

Munich/Frankfurt, 19 June 2023 – ABG Real Estate Group has entered into a long-term lease agreement with global consulting firm Alvarez & Marsal for approx. 3,000 sqm in its FRANZ building in the heart of Munich’s city centre (Sonnenstrasse 20), just shortly after the topping-out ceremony on 24 May 2023. Alvarez & Marsal are scheduled to move their German headquarters from the Lehel-District into the new premises in the first quarter of 2024, where they will not only benefit from the innovative “new work” office design, but also from the spacious outdoor areas in the inner courtyard together with parking spaces and a useful bicycle garage in the basement. 70 per cent of the FRANZ’s available office space has already been let.

The FRANZ project in Munich:

ABG, together with two occupational pension plans as joint venture partners, purchased the property in September 2021. Familiar to many from the popular 1980s television series “Monaco Franze”, the building is very close to Munich’s famous “Stachus” square. Construction work began in spring 2022. The existing 1950s seven-storey building has been gutted and revitalised in line with current high environmental and quality standards, offering a far better carbon footprint than if it had been demolished and rebuilt. A new three-storey building with floor-to-ceiling windows was added in the green inner courtyard: altogether, FRANZ will offer its residential and office users 5,000 sqm of highly flexible floor space, right in the heart of the city. Total investment volume amounts to approximately €70 million.

Details of the FRANZ project:

•    The project’s name was inspired by “Monaco Franze”, a popular 1980s German television series: the programme was filmed using the original building at Sonnenstrasse 20, making the address well-known throughout Germany as the location for the title character’s private investigations firm.
•    Built in 1953, the building housed residential and commercial users until 2020, with the vacancy rate rising steadily as the building aged. By September 2021 ABG and its joint venture partners, two occupational pension plans, were able to purchase the building gutted and unlet.
•    The main building comprises seven upper storeys (including the ground floor) plus one basement level. The first five storeys are designed for flexible use and all types of new work, the two upper floors will offer space for eight light-flooded apartments, providing unique views of the city and the Alps, and the ground floor will house an attractive entrance vestibule and variable conference rooms. The building boasts not only a full-length terrace on the first floor at the back of the building, but also various balconies – and facing Sonnenstrasse, a new high-grade, sandstone-coloured travertine façade for storeys 1 through 5 contrasts with a distinctive, dark granite-coloured façade for the ground floor. The above-ground car parking spaces will be moved to the basement, accompanied by 22 bicycle spaces. This combined parking space will offer charging stations for electric cars and ten e-bikes.
•    The main building will be complemented by a three-storey new-build with floor-to-ceiling windows on the side facing the green inner courtyard, offering bright and open top-quality office space.
•    Munich-based architects Wolfgang Scherer Architekten and Schemmel Architekten are supporting the construction work which started in February 2022. Completion of the building is scheduled for the end of 2023, by which time it will have received a WiredScore and a BREEAM sustainability rating.
